Toyota Yaris: Flat Tire / Spare Tire and Tool Storage
Spare tire and tools are stored in the locations illustrated in the diagram.
4-Door
- Spare tire
- Spare tire hold-down bolt
- Tool bag
- Jack
- Jack point attachment* 1
- Jack lever
- Tiedown eyelet (if equipped)
- Lug wrench
- Flat tire belt
* 1: The jack point attachment can be used by vehicle
repair shops and
road assistance services. Consult your Toyota dealer for details.
